Nestled in the heart of Chattanooga, Ruby Falls offers visitors a breathtaking underground waterfall experience, surrounded by stunning natural beauty. As one of the nation's tallest underground waterfalls, it captivates tourists with its awe-inspiring views and rich geological history. The guided tours provide an educational insight into the formation of this natural wonder while showcasing the beauty of its caves. Public Bus
From downtown Chattanooga, you can take the CARTA bus #4 (Lookout Mountain route) from any stop along the route. Board the bus at the nearest stop to your location and pay the fare. The bus will take you towards Lookout Mountain. Stay on the bus for approximately 20-30 minutes, depending on traffic and stops. Disembark at the Ruby Falls stop, which is near the entrance to Ruby Falls. Follow the signs to the entrance, which is about a 5-minute walk from the bus stop.
Walking
If you are staying in a nearby hotel or area close to Ruby Falls, you can walk there. Start by heading west on W 4th St towards the Scenic Hwy. Continue onto Lookout Mountain and follow Scenic Hwy until you reach Ruby Falls, which is located at 1720 Scenic Hwy. The walk may take around 45 minutes to an hour depending on your pace.
Rideshare
For a more direct route, consider using a rideshare service like Uber or Lyft. Open the app and set your destination to Ruby Falls, 1720 Scenic Hwy, Chattanooga, TN 37409. A rideshare will pick you up at your current location and take you directly to the entrance of Ruby Falls. The ride will typically take about 15-20 minutes from downtown Chattanooga, depending on traffic.
Bicycle
If you're comfortable biking, you can rent a bicycle from a local rental shop in downtown Chattanooga. Head towards Lookout Mountain and follow the bike paths that lead you to Scenic Hwy. The ride may take approximately 30-40 minutes. Follow the paved paths and signs directing you towards Ruby Falls, which is located at 1720 Scenic Hwy.
